The Front view clearly shows the overall height, the arrangement of the bolt holes on the top and bottom flanges, and the central bore, providing essential information for assembly and alignment.
The Top view reveals the circular gear teeth pattern and the central bore, which are critical for understanding the internal gear mesh and the coupling's functional geometry.
The section cut along the YZ plane reveals the internal gear teeth engagement and the wall thickness of the coupling, which are not visible in the external views.

The detail view magnifies the bolt hole pattern on the flange, providing a clear view of the hole diameter and spacing for accurate manufacturing.
